Output 25b959c7d60b163905b5db77d6ea6a97af8b5f592bbf30344343d473d8de25a9:1

value
33520978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2507c291db419553609feeb0d84f96037fefbca2 OP_EQUAL
address
MBGxXhqF4g4tzxrya7UYx9tHPYvZzjHHvC
transaction
25b959c7d60b163905b5db77d6ea6a97af8b5f592bbf30344343d473d8de25a9
spent
true